21xrx.com
2024-05-20 13:39:05 Monday
登录
文章检索 我的文章 写文章
使用FFmpeg进行屏幕截图操作
2023-11-17 18:11:40 深夜i     --     --
FFmpeg 屏幕截图 操作

FFmpeg是一种强大的多媒体处理工具,它不仅能够处理音视频文件,还可以进行屏幕截图操作。在本文中,我们将介绍如何使用FFmpeg进行屏幕截图。

首先,我们需要安装FFmpeg。它可以在Windows、Mac和Linux等不同操作系统上运行。可以通过访问官方网站https://ffmpeg.org/来获取FFmpeg的最新版本。安装完成后,我们需要设置环境变量,以便在命令行中能够直接使用FFmpeg命令。

接下来,我们需要找到想要截图的屏幕区域。在Windows系统中,可以使用Win+Shift+S快捷键来打开“选择区域”工具,然后点击鼠标左键并拖动以选择截图区域。在Mac系统中,可以使用Command+Shift+4快捷键来截取屏幕区域。

在我们选择了需要截图的屏幕区域后,我们可以使用以下命令进行截图操作:


ffmpeg -f avfoundation -i "1" -ss 00:00:01 -frames:v 1 screenshot.jpg

这条命令使用了avfoundation设备来捕获屏幕内容。其中的数字1表示使用默认的屏幕设备,如果你有多个显示器,可以选择不同的设备进行截图。-ss指定了截图的起始时间,这里设置为00:00:01,表示从视频的第一秒开始截图。-frames:v 1表示只截取一帧画面。最后的screenshot.jpg是保存截图的文件名。

执行完上述命令后,FFmpeg会将截图保存为指定的文件名。根据你选择的截图区域大小和屏幕分辨率,截图的分辨率可能会有所不同。

除了屏幕截图,FFmpeg还可以进行更多的多媒体处理操作,如视频剪辑、音频提取等。它不仅功能强大,而且支持众多的音视频编解码格式,让我们可以对各种多媒体文件进行处理。

总结起来,使用FFmpeg进行屏幕截图操作非常简单。只需要安装并设置好FFmpeg,然后选择需要截图的屏幕区域并执行相关命令即可。希望这篇文章能够帮助你进行屏幕截图操作,并了解到FFmpeg多媒体处理工具的强大功能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复